From the Red Deer RCMP: April 6th, 2020:
Red Deer RCMP wish to thank the public for their assistance in locating Yuri Butorin. Yuri was located later the same afternoon in good health.

From the Red Deer RCMP: April 5th, 2020.
Red Deer RCMP are asking for the public’s assistance to locate 39-year-old Yuri Butorin who is reported missing after a day trip to Abraham Lake. Yuri was last seen at 12 p.m. on April 4 in Red Deer. Yuri drove alone to Abraham Lake in Clearwater County on April 4th and did not return home as expected. Police are concerned for his well-being.
Yuri is described as:
- Caucasian
- 5’7”
- 220lbs
- Grey hair
- Brown eyes
- Grey facial hair
- Last seen wearing light grey winter jacket, black sweat pants, and a black hat
Yuri was driving a beige/silver 2004 Mitsubishi Delica minivan with license plate CDK2977. Police believe Yuri is in the Clearwater County area. A photo of Yuri is attached.
